📜  删除本地 nuget 缓存 - Shell-Bash (1)

📅  最后修改于: 2023-12-03 15:22:43.765000             🧑  作者: Mango

删除本地 nuget 缓存 - Shell/Bash

在开发过程中,我们使用 NuGet 包管理器来获取依赖。但是,每次我们添加、删除或更新依赖项时,NuGet 都会在本地缓存中存储新版本。随着时间的推移,这些缓存可能会变得非常大,消耗大量空间。在这种情况下,清理缓存就很有必要了,本文将介绍使用 Shell/Bash 删除本地 nuget 缓存的方法。

查看 nuget 缓存目录

NuGet 缓存默认位于用户主文件夹的 nuget/packages 目录下。可以使用以下命令在终端中查看该目录的位置:

echo $HOME/.nuget/packages

它将返回像 /Users/username/.nuget/packages 这样的路径。

删除 nuget 缓存

可以使用 rm 命令在终端中删除 NuGet 缓存。以下是递归删除 nuget/packages 目录下所有文件和文件夹的示例命令:

rm -rf $HOME/.nuget/packages/*

注意:请确保仔细检查输入的删除命令并确认它不会删除任何重要文件。

结论

使用 Shell/Bash 可以轻松删除本地 nuget 缓存。这项操作可以帮助您节省大量硬盘空间,使开发过程更加流畅。在执行删除操作之前,请确保备份所有重要文件和数据。